Basement Drainage Installation in Des Moines, IA
Basement drainage installation services involve setting up systems that help manage excess water around a property’s foundation and prevent basement flooding or water damage. These projects typically include installing drainage pipes, sump pumps, and gravel or membrane barriers to direct water away from the foundation. Homeowners often seek this service when experiencing persistent dampness, water seepage, or flooding issues in their basements, especially after heavy rains or rapid snowmelt. Proper drainage installation can improve basement dryness, protect property value, and reduce the risk of structural damage caused by water infiltration.
Before requesting basement drainage installation, property owners usually want to understand the scope of work involved, including the types of drainage solutions suitable for their property’s soil and landscape. It’s also important to consider the existing foundation condition and any necessary excavation or landscaping adjustments. Clear communication about the project's goals, such as preventing future flooding or managing groundwater, helps ensure the right system is designed and installed. Proper planning and understanding of the process can lead to more effective and long-lasting drainage solutions tailored to the specific needs of the property.

Common Basement Drainage Installation Jobs
Basement Drainage Systems - installed to direct water away from foundation walls and prevent flooding.
French Drains - designed to collect and redirect groundwater effectively.
Sump Pump Installations - used to remove accumulated water from basement areas.
Interior Drainage Solutions - help manage seepage and moisture inside the basement.
Drainage Channeling - installed along the foundation to guide water flow away from the property.
Waterproofing Drainage - integrated with drainage systems to keep basements dry and protected.
Basement Drainage Installation Questions
What is basement drainage installation? It involves setting up systems to prevent water from accumulating in the basement, helping to keep the area dry and protected from water damage.
Why is proper drainage important for basements? Proper drainage reduces the risk of flooding, mold growth, and structural issues caused by excess moisture.
What types of drainage systems are commonly installed? Common options include interior sump pumps, exterior drain tiles, and perimeter drainage systems designed to divert water away from the foundation.
How can I tell if my basement needs drainage improvements? Signs include damp walls, musty odors, water pooling during heavy rain, or cracks in the foundation walls.
